Summary

This Bike Shop was established in 1985. The present owner was hired as a manager in 1986 and took ownership of the store in 2004. The revenues of the store are equally divided between bike sales, repairs and parts. It is situated in Highland Park, which borders Pasadena and Eagle Rock , areas known for bicycle enthusiasts.

Over the years it has built a strong reputation and client list. It caters to all variety of bicyclists. From children getting their first bike to week-end warriors and racers.
There are several obvious ways that a new owner can grow the business. The first one would be to expand the hours of operation. The store is only open Monday, Tuesday, Thursday, Friday and Saturday from 1 pm to 6 pm. Also, the store does not spend any money on marketing ( No fliers, no coupons, no ads). The store does not have a web site. The owner believes that a new owner could increase sales dramatically if any of the above ideas were put into action. The owner is selling because after 24 years of running the operation, he would rather be riding his bike then working indoors.

The ideal buyer would be a bicycle enthusiast who has a working knowledge of repairing a bike. The owner will train the buyer and will also be available to fill in from time to time, if the buyer should need him.
